Identifying Effective Sustainable Development Indicators for Airport Construction Projects: Zahedan International Airport in Iran as Case Study
Airport plays an important role in the heart of the regions in which they are located, as well as in certain sectors of activity, such as tourism. Air transport makes a major contribution to sustainable development by supporting and promoting international tourism. The available rating systems need to better incorporate the broader socioeconomic settings associated with the built environment. This paper identified key indicators for assessing the sustainability performance of an airport construction projects. The research data used for analysis were collected from a questionnaire survey given to three groups of experts, including employer, consulting engineers, and contractors of Iranian airport construction projects. The importance of sustainability indicators was identified by using statistical analysis and software such as SPSS. The fuzzy set theory was used to establish key assessment indicators (KAIs). Cronbach’s alpha coefficient method was used in this study to evaluate the data reliability. A questionnaire survey among practitioners confirmed the necessity and identified priority indicators of sustainability. A procedure for using the KAIs is demonstrated by a case study. The research results demonstrated the importance of sustainability knowledge, indicators, as a positive step toward assessing sustainability in airport projects. The authors identified 25 key indicators of airport construction projects based on Iran conditions that are consistent with the principles of sustainable development. Findings showed that technical aspect with a weight factor of 32% is the highest aspect and then economic and environment aspects with 24% and, finally, social aspect with 20%.
